    • A method for processing an imagewise exposed color photographic material using fast developing time while maintaining stable processing conditions, reduced developer replenishing, and light fastness of developed color images. The method comprises developing a color photographic material containing silver halide grains comprising (i) substantially no silver iodide and (ii) at least about 80 mol % silver chloride with a developer comprising (i) substantially no benzyl alcohol and (ii) a p-phenylenediamine derivative represented by the formula (I): ##STR1## wherein R.sup.1 and R.sup.2 each represents an alkyl group having from 1 to 4 carbon atoms and R.sup.2 represents a straight chain or branched alkylene group having 3 or 4 carbon atoms and wherein the developing is for a period of time of less than 30 seconds.

    • A method for processing a silver halide color photographic material comprising a reflective support having thereon at least one light-sensitive silver halide emulsion layer containing a color coupler or color couplers, which comprises the step of, after imagewise exposing, developing said silver halide color photographic material with a color developing solution which does not substantially contain benzyl alcohol and which contains an aromatic primary amine color developing agent represented by formula (A): ##STR1## wherein X represents a compound capable of forming a salt with a primary amine; and a compound represented by formula (I): ##STR2## wherein R.sup.1 represents a hydrogen atom or a substituted or unsubstituted alkyl, aryl, alkoxy, aryloxy or amino group; and R.sup.2 represents a hydrogen atom or a substituted or unsubstituted alkyl or aryl group; or R.sup.1 and R.sup.2 may be bonded to each other to form a carbon ring or a hetero-ring.The color developing solution used in the present method has improved stability and color forming properties.

    • A silver halide photographic material comprises at least one light-sensitive emulsion layer containing a silver halide emulsion on a support. The light-sensitive emulsion layer comprises (a) a silver halide emulsion containing silver halide grains having a silver chloride content of 90 mol % or more, in some cases 95 mol % or more, and (b) at least one compound represented by formula (I), (II) or (III): ##STR1## in which the variables are as defined in the specification. In some embodiments of the invention, the silver halide emulsion (a) may be sensitized with a selenium, gold or iridium compound. Also, in some embodiments of the invention, the silver halide grains are substantially iodide-free and have a localized phase with a silver bromide content of 10% or more in the vicinity of the grain surface.
